Decent software hampered by poor hardware.
||Posted . Owned for 2 months when reviewed.This reviewer received promo considerations or sweepstakes entry for writing a review.Ive owned a classic Chromecast for years now. I purchased the new Chromecast 4K as soon as it came out. The user interface is decent when it works. The video quality is great and an obvious improvement over the classic Chromecast HD. Unfortunately, the WiFi repeatedly disconnects even as my old Chromecast in the same room stays connected. Sometimes an app will stall requiring a reboot of the Chromecast. The remote stopped working entirely after a week, and would not respond to repairing attempts. After two months, the Chromecast no longer boots and I have the orange light of death. Making a warranty claim with Google is a painful process. I spend my days troubleshooting tech, and I generally want my home to Just Work. I've switched to a small Linux PC with 4K output (Intel NUC) and I'm very happy with the quality and stability. tl;dr: It looks great but it was not worth the time I spent troubleshooting it.

Posted .Hi CB716, thanks for reaching out. We’re glad you loved the menu layout and functions for Chromecast with Google TV. However, we do apologize for the poor experience with the Bluetooth pairing issue.
If you’re willing to try, here are some suggested steps that may be helpful with the Bluetooth pairing issue:
1. Check for Chromecast remote updates under Google TV settings, Remotes and Accessories.
2. Perform a factory reset on the remote. In the upper right of your TV screen, select your profile and then Settings. Select System > and then About > and select Factory Reset.
3. Pair Voice Remote with Chromecast and perform the following steps below after pairing:
- Check that the batteries in the remote have remaining charges.
- Remove the batteries from the remote.
- Press and hold the Home button Voice remote home button.
- While holding the button, reinsert the batteries.
- Hold the button while the LED light is solid.
- When the light starts pulsing, release the button.
If your Voice Remote still disconnects from Chromecast with Google TV, we recommend contacting our support team for further isolation and troubleshooting here: https://support.google.com/chromecast/gethelp

Posted .Hi thoffy1,
Thanks for sharing some insights. We're sorry to hear of the performance issue with your Chromecast with Google TV.
Your Chromecast with Google TV was designed to provide you with a smooth experience. We recommend on trying out the troubleshooting steps below to see if the issue could be related to factors other than your Chromecast device:
- Ensure that your Chromecast is connected to your 5 GHz Wi-Fi network.
- Remove other connected devices on your Wi-Fi network and see if you will still encounter the same issue. Should you verify congestion, then we recommend contacting your internet service provider for resolution.
- We recommend a Wi-Fi network with 25 Mbps download speed that can ensure smooth 4K experience.
- If it does not work, you may try restarting your Chromecast by going to Settings > System > Restart.
- If it's still unresolved, perform a factory reset on the Chromecast with Google TV:
a. While the Chromecast is plugged into the TV, hold down the button on the Chromecast device for at least 25 seconds or until the solid LED light turns into a flashing red light.
b. Once the LED light turns blinking white and the TV goes blank, release the button. The Chromecast device will begin the reboot sequence.
